Output 95359d7a7d41666db8baa0a09d64778d1f093f9e421afa979a9cdc4f44f95c08:135

value
312673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a60f9887470915c94638ca5cab4108f4d086612 OP_EQUAL
address
35Z6UXKa3dX6N9Ns7hbTcudhi7gwtWxXZy
transaction
95359d7a7d41666db8baa0a09d64778d1f093f9e421afa979a9cdc4f44f95c08
spent
true